The relentless demand of daily algorithms took a heavy psychological toll on the workforce. By late August 2022, the industry faced a widespread conversation regarding creator burnout. The pressure to feed the algorithmic beast daily caused many prominent figures to step back, prompting a career re-evaluation across the industry. The creators who survived this period were those who successfully transitioned from being the "face" of the brand to executive producers, shifting toward content formats that did not require their physical presence in every frame.
